ShaadiWish launches The Promise - the post-wedding photoshoot where a couple relives their 38 years in seven frames

News Agencies | Updated on: 13 September 2017, 15:34 IST
Shaddiwish (ANI)

In a world where pre-wedding photoshoot has become the norm, ShaadiWish.com conceptualised this to capture raw and unadulterated moments with a couple who has spent a lifetime together-the true reflection of everlasting love.

They went to Instagram and found the cutest nana-nani ever through two dozen beautiful entries and tried to frame the magical life they have lived in just seven frames. Every frame a promise, a little tribute to treasured memories of a life absolutely cherished.

What we love about the shoot is the honest charm of it all. This is no destination wedding, no Bollywood designer bride or a suave farmhouse in Italy but as you scroll through these humble images of a home you will feel a contagious happy mush that only true love can bring.

"We came up with this post wedding photoshoot concept to start a small disruption hopefully in the same kind of wedding content we are seeing from more than a decade now. As much as we love young couples taking beautiful pictures in an Udaipur palace we believe every wedding vendor should create something original and try to tap into a new trend without always following one. That's where we come in, we don't promote the content already made in the same four ways for everyone, we create unique aspirational campaigns and market the people we collab with and not ourselves the way it has been happening in this category." said Divyata Shergill, Founder, ShaadiWish.

"The couple, Arun and Shachi was arranged by destiny in Jaipur and we love the way she drapes that Ekaya Banaras saree and the magic touch of OurWeddingChapter specially in the shot where these two adorably cute veterans are jumping in the bed like two teenagers in love. The first dance in a club in Colombo, the first movie in Regal, the unbroken morning tea ritual of three decades... Ah the ecstasy to have these moments carved in time, framed with love; a gentle inspiration for your grandchildren. That's the true legacy of love and celebration of marriage," she added.
